Does BingX Have the Edge With Its Unique Features?

BingX is another player in the Australian market that is worth considering. This exchange is known for its social trading features, allowing users to mimic the trades of successful investors. This can be a fantastic way for beginners to gain insights into effective trading strategies while reducing the learning curve.

Moreover, BingX supports a variety of cryptocurrencies and offers appealing trading fees. However, its security measures and customer support may not be as robust as those offered by Bitget, which could be a consideration if user support is a top priority for you.

Can Coinbase Compete in the Australian Market?

Coinbase is perhaps the most recognizable name in the cryptocurrency ecosystem. Known for its straightforward interface and educational resources, it has attracted millions of users globally. But is it the best option for Australians?

While Coinbase offers a wide range of cryptocurrencies and has a solid reputation for security, it may not be the most cost-effective choice for frequent traders due to its fees. Moreover, Coinbase's advanced trading options may be somewhat limited compared to Bitget’s various derivatives offerings.

Which Exchange Offers Better Rates and Fees?

When comparing rates and fees between these exchanges, it’s essential to consider what type of trading you'll be doing. Bitget often stands out with its competitive trading fees, especially for derivatives, which can attract serious traders looking to maximize their profits.

BingX also offers low fees, particularly for those who engage in social trading, while Coinbase tends to have higher fees that can eat into profits, especially for frequent transactions. Thus, the choice might largely depend on your trading style and frequency.
